The new, version 1.3.14 of Python for S60 has been released. Compared with the version 1.3.11 (which was the last version we noted), the new version brings the following improvements:

  • Calendar has now been implemented for S60 3rd edition
  • Orientation switch and callback when screen change in canvas
  • Initial version of the contacts module for 3.0 has been added
  • Added support for OpenGL ES 1.0 – runs on all devices since Nokia 6630, and even supports the hardware acceleration on the N93
  • Added new method that gives access to device’s text-to-speech engine
  • And, of course, many of the known bugs are fixed
